How did the constitution set up the government

History
1 answer:
Ugo [173]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

First it creates a national government consisting of a legislative, an executive, and a judicial branch, with a system of checks and balances among the three branches. Second, it divides power between the federal government and the states. And third, it protects various individual liberties of American citizens.
